Hang in there

Letter Carrier Dang Hang was recently delivering mail to a residence in Stockton, CA, when he heard a loud thud that concerned him.

Hang spotted a customer inside who’d collapsed after experiencing a diabetes-related blackout.

The Postal Service employee immediately called 911 and remained on the scene until paramedics arrived and took the woman to a hospital.

The customer, who recovered from the incident, later contacted the local Post Office.

She called Hang her guardian angel and thanked him for saving her life.
